About This Topic

Travel as an academic topic spans multiple disciplines, including hospitality management, business strategy, economics, and cultural studies. Students engage with it in courses ranging from tourism management to international business, where it raises questions about how people move across borders, how industries are built around that movement, and how economic and cultural forces shape both. The subject is academically rich because it connects individual behavior to large-scale systems, linking consumer choices, corporate strategy, and national policy within a single framework.

The papers archived under this topic reflect a wide range of approaches. Some take an industry analysis angle, examining strategic management in hospitality companies and how businesses like hotels position themselves competitively. Others focus on tourism trends, exploring how tourism types evolve and what drives changes in traveler demand. Consumer behavior studies appear as well, such as work examining how customers in specific markets select low-cost airlines based on perception and cost. Additional papers address service delivery strategy and international trade and investment as they relate to travel-dependent industries, grounding abstract business concepts in real-world contexts.

A strong essay on travel should establish a focused thesis rather than broadly surveying the entire industry. Claims carry more weight when supported by specific market data, policy examples, or clearly defined case studies. Comparative analysis — weighing two companies, two tourism models, or two national strategies against each other — tends to produce sharper arguments than single-subject descriptions. The most common pitfall is treating travel as a purely positive economic force without accounting for costs, including labor concerns, environmental impact, or market volatility, all of which regularly surface in serious academic treatment of the topic.
